Cashrewards is offering $45 cashback on Boost's $250 260GB 1-year SIM

Multiple SIM purchases need to be made as separate transactions. Adding more than one SIM to an order will result in an untracked purchase.

SIM must be activated within 30 days of ordering.

Cashback is ineligible on prepaid phones, recharges, and any plans or products not specifically listed in the cashback table of rates.

You must return and click through Cashrewards for each new transaction.

  • Can anyone please tell me what the deal is with joining Boost again after my current 12 month SIM plan ends, can I use this as an existing customer or do I need to port off Telstra/Boost network first and if so how long ? Thanks

    • +3

      You are not supposed to be able to use this as an existing customer, but sometimes you can contact a boost rep & they will manually activate/transfer your service for you.

      Its a lot of hassle though, easier is to buy some cheap non telstra/boost sim, transfer out for a day then activate the new sim to transfer back.

      • thanks !

      • Do you have to wait a day? Can you just do it within the time you switch and activate on boost?

        • +1

          You don't have to, but there have been stories of porting in & out immediately causing dramas with their backend systems as your old data hasn't been flushed yet. Never happened to me, but I always wait. The temp Sim usually has some data to burn anyway so why not use it.

          If the idea is to avoid having to call their support staff, best to just give it a day or 2 to clear.
